### Changed

Heads up for review: in Squatsniff 2.3 we renamed `SCAN_REGISTRY_TOKEN_OLD` to a clearer name after the typo-squat scanner grew a second registry backend. The old name still works but warns loudly. Migration is just a rename in the env file — update the key name, keep your existing value, and place the credential on the line right after this note.

sealed setting: VAULT_KEY20=c8ea1e419912889df6b4

Step 4: Enable idempotency keys for payment retries in Tillgate. When a customer reports a duplicate charge, the retry worker must reuse the original key, so confirm the dedupe window is set to 24 hours before restarting. Support should never clear keys manually. Once verified, add the signing secret to the worker's env file on the line below.

vault entry, yahif-yajep: COURIER_KEY29=b802bdf8034096b65a51c6ba5abe2

## Artifact signing — RestockPilot

Quick notes for on-call: the vending-machine restock planner ships as a signed tarball to the Birchline depot controllers. Controllers won't install anything unsigned, so if a deploy stalls, check the signature first — nine times out of ten it's a key mismatch, not the planner itself. Re-sign with the current key and push again; no restart needed. The current deploy key is right here.

release key, fahaf-bajof: bky3_Xam

# Idempotency keys for payment retries (Tillfast gateway)
# Every charge attempt carries a key derived from order ID plus
# attempt window, stored for 72 hours. A retry with a seen key
# returns the cached result rather than re-charging. Before each
# release, verify the key-store TTL job is scheduled; a lapsed TTL
# causes unbounded growth. The key store uses the following
# connection string.

replica DSN, yahaf-yagaf: mongodb://tamath_svc:a2netSk3RZMuTj@db-d084.novacsoft.internal:5432/ralmir